2010-02-27 5 views
0

Помогите, мне очень больно использовать это множество nbsps на моей странице результатов. Я просто новичок. Можете ли вы порекомендовать мне некоторые методы, чтобы я не копировал вставку этой серии nbsp, чтобы получить пространство и разрывы строк, которые мне нужны.избавление от nbsp

while($row = mysql_fetch_array($result)) 
     { 
     echo "Patient #:". " ". " ". " ". " ". $row['PNUM']; 

    echo "<B>"."Hospital #:"."</B>".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['HOSPNUM']."&nbsp;"."&nbsp;"."&nbsp;"; 
     echo "<B>"."Room:".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['ROOMNUM']; 
     echo "<B>"."Lastname:".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['LASTNAME']; 
     echo "<B>"."Firstname:".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['FIRSTNAME']; 
     echo "<B>"."Middlename:".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['MIDNAME']; 
      echo "<B>"."Admission Date:".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['ADATE']; 
      echo "<B>"."Admission Time:".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['ADTIME']; 
       echo "<B>"."Patient #:". "&nbsp;". "&nbsp;". "&nbsp;". "&nbsp;". $row['PNUM']; 

     } 
+0

Что не так с ' '? –

+6

Если вы используете ' ' для форматирования столбцов для представления * данных *, это ошибка номер один. –

ответ

5

ли это быть открытым текстом или вы можете отобразить это в table?

<table> 
<tr> 
    <th>Patient #</th> 
    <th>Hospital #</th> 
    <th>Room</th> 
    <!-- etc. --> 
</tr> 
while($row = mysql_fetch_array($result)) 
{ 
    echo "<tr>"; 
    echo "<td>$row['PNUM']</td>"; 
    echo "<td>$row['HOSPNUM']</td>"; 
    echo "<td>$row['ROOMNUM']</td>"; 
    // etc. 
    echo "</tr>"; 
} 
</table> 
+0

HTML-инъекция (XSS). Требуется 'htmlspecialchars'. – bobince

4

Рассмотрим таблицы или списки определений

1

если ваш выход в основном для отладки, вы можете выводить свои результаты в pre теге, предварительно тега, предварительно служить пространство и разрывы строк

, если нет, то вы должны изучить некоторый HTML (и CSS), несколько возможностей - это списки, таблицы или пользовательская разметка с помощью стиля css